Basic Radio 101 Trainers Guide Pdf The abcs of radio communications relate directly to the composition of any message broadcast over the radio. before transmitting a message, think about what you want to say and make sure you’re presenting accurate information. This lesson introduces communication skills that are specific to cert operations, and helps you understand differences from normal amateur radio operations. *an emergency communicator must do his part to get every message to its intended recipient, quickly, accurately, and with a minimum of fuss*.
